Subject: [PATCH 7/8] staging:iio:dac:ad5446: Consolidate store_sample and store_pwr_down functions
Date: Mon, 23 Apr 2012 19:51:36 +0200	[thread overview]
Message-ID: <1335203497-11041-7-git-send-email-lars@metafoo.de> (raw)
In-Reply-To: <1335203497-11041-1-git-send-email-lars@metafoo.de>

The devices supported by this drivers only have a single shift register, which
contains both the power down mode and the output sample. So writing the power
down mode and the output sample can be done by the same function. The two power
down bits are always placed ontop of the msb of the output sample, so we can
easily calculate their position by adding the channels shift to the channels
realbits.

Signed-off-by: Lars-Peter Clausen <lars@metafoo.de>
---
 drivers/staging/iio/dac/ad5446.c |   38 ++++++++++----------------------------
 1 file changed, 10 insertions(+), 28 deletions(-)

diff --git a/drivers/staging/iio/dac/ad5446.c b/drivers/staging/iio/dac/ad5446.c
index c767024..90461b2 100644
--- a/drivers/staging/iio/dac/ad5446.c
+++ b/drivers/staging/iio/dac/ad5446.c
@@ -31,21 +31,6 @@ static void ad5446_store_sample(struct ad5446_state *st, unsigned val)
 
 static void ad5660_store_sample(struct ad5446_state *st, unsigned val)
 {
-	val |= AD5660_LOAD;
-	st->data.d24[0] = (val >> 16) & 0xFF;
-	st->data.d24[1] = (val >> 8) & 0xFF;
-	st->data.d24[2] = val & 0xFF;
-}
-
-static void ad5620_store_pwr_down(struct ad5446_state *st, unsigned mode)
-{
-	st->data.d16 = cpu_to_be16(mode << 14);
-}
-
-static void ad5660_store_pwr_down(struct ad5446_state *st, unsigned mode)
-{
-	unsigned val = mode << 16;
-
 	st->data.d24[0] = (val >> 16) & 0xFF;
 	st->data.d24[1] = (val >> 8) & 0xFF;
 	st->data.d24[2] = val & 0xFF;
@@ -105,6 +90,8 @@ static ssize_t ad5446_write_dac_powerdown(struct iio_dev *indio_dev,
 					    const char *buf, size_t len)
 {
 	struct ad5446_state *st = iio_priv(indio_dev);
+	unsigned int shift;
+	unsigned int val;
 	bool powerdown;
 	int ret;
 
@@ -115,10 +102,14 @@ static ssize_t ad5446_write_dac_powerdown(struct iio_dev *indio_dev,
 	mutex_lock(&indio_dev->mlock);
 	st->pwr_down = powerdown;
 
-	if (st->pwr_down)
-		st->chip_info->store_pwr_down(st, st->pwr_down_mode);
-	else
-		st->chip_info->store_sample(st, st->cached_val);
+	if (st->pwr_down) {
+		shift = chan->scan_type.realbits + chan->scan_type.shift;
+		val = st->pwr_down_mode << shift;
+	} else {
+		val = st->cached_val;
+	}
+
+	st->chip_info->store_sample(st, val);
 
 	ret = spi_sync(st->spi, &st->msg);
 	mutex_unlock(&indio_dev->mlock);
@@ -186,53 +177,44 @@ static const struct ad5446_chip_info ad5446_chip_info_tbl[] = {
 	[ID_AD5601] = {
 		.channel = AD5446_CHANNEL_POWERDOWN(8, 16, 6),
 		.store_sample = ad5446_store_sample,
-		.store_pwr_down = ad5620_store_pwr_down,
 	},
 	[ID_AD5611] = {
 		.channel = AD5446_CHANNEL_POWERDOWN(10, 16, 4),
 		.store_sample = ad5446_store_sample,
-		.store_pwr_down = ad5620_store_pwr_down,
 	},
 	[ID_AD5621] = {
 		.channel = AD5446_CHANNEL_POWERDOWN(12, 16, 2),
 		.store_sample = ad5446_store_sample,
-		.store_pwr_down = ad5620_store_pwr_down,
 	},
 	[ID_AD5620_2500] = {
 		.channel = AD5446_CHANNEL_POWERDOWN(12, 16, 2),
 		.int_vref_mv = 2500,
 		.store_sample = ad5446_store_sample,
-		.store_pwr_down = ad5620_store_pwr_down,
 	},
 	[ID_AD5620_1250] = {
 		.channel = AD5446_CHANNEL_POWERDOWN(12, 16, 2),
 		.int_vref_mv = 1250,
 		.store_sample = ad5446_store_sample,
-		.store_pwr_down = ad5620_store_pwr_down,
 	},
 	[ID_AD5640_2500] = {
 		.channel = AD5446_CHANNEL_POWERDOWN(14, 16, 0),
 		.int_vref_mv = 2500,
 		.store_sample = ad5446_store_sample,
-		.store_pwr_down = ad5620_store_pwr_down,
 	},
 	[ID_AD5640_1250] = {
 		.channel = AD5446_CHANNEL_POWERDOWN(14, 16, 0),
 		.int_vref_mv = 1250,
 		.store_sample = ad5446_store_sample,
-		.store_pwr_down = ad5620_store_pwr_down,
 	},
 	[ID_AD5660_2500] = {
 		.channel = AD5446_CHANNEL_POWERDOWN(16, 16, 0),
 		.int_vref_mv = 2500,
 		.store_sample = ad5660_store_sample,
-		.store_pwr_down = ad5660_store_pwr_down,
 	},
 	[ID_AD5660_1250] = {
 		.channel = AD5446_CHANNEL_POWERDOWN(16, 16, 0),
 		.int_vref_mv = 1250,
 		.store_sample = ad5660_store_sample,
-		.store_pwr_down = ad5660_store_pwr_down,
 	},
 };
